A 18-Bore East India Government Percussion Service Pistol
A 18-Bore East India Government Percussion Service Pistol
Dated 1871
With sighted barrel and tang, dated flat lock stamped 'Birmingham' and with 'EIG' crowned on the tail, full stock (bruised, butt split and repaired) stamped with indistinct inspector's marks, and with circular Birmingham 'E.I.G' mark and supplier's name 'Joseph Bourne & Son' opposite the lock, regulation brass mounts including ovoidal butt-cap with lanyard swivel, and stirrup ramrod (steel parts with some light pitting), Ordnance view and proof marks
20.4 cm. barrel
Sold for £687 inc. premium
